Drug Rehab in Petoskey

Drug rehab is Petoskey is accessible in a variety of settings including outpatient, inpatient and residential centers. It is necessary for anybody considering these options and what one is going to prove most beneficial for them to understand the kind of center compliments their level of rehab need depending on their history of drug use. Usually, the more extreme the addiction the more someone will likely need to be in rehab and an outpatient program really isn't a workable choice in these cases. Outpatient drug rehab in Petoskey is not a practical selection generally speaking no matter the level of addiction being handled because somebody who is using drugs or using alcohol requires a change of environment to become well. Staying home while in rehabilitation may seem convenient, but staying in a place where one is vulnerable to unhandled stressors which most likely trigger one's drug abuse defeats the purpose over time. So someone who wants to stop their addiction before it worsens even when it is a new issue will really want to look for treatment within an inpatient or residential drug rehab in Petoskey even if it's a short-term program.

The main difference between short-term and long-term is either a short 30-day drug and alcohol treatment program in Petoskey or long-term which can be typically 90-120 days. The short-term 30-day drug rehab in Petoskey choices are programs which primarily concentrate on getting the individual through detox and withdrawal so that they are physically stabilized, and then do as much as they are able to during the rest of their stay to help them have the ability to continue to be sober. This could include counseling and therapeutic methods and helping them make changes in lifestyle so that they can remove detrimental influences from their life that may cause a relapse. 30 days is a very brief amount of time to be able to achieve all of this and anyone searching for treatment in a short-term rehab must be aware that it isn't always an effective effort as a consequence of how brief the rehabilitation period is. If a person has experienced a life threatening drug or alcohol issue, the best thing to do is to reevaluate one's situation prior to leaving a short-term drug rehab in Petoskey, and if you find more to get done it is always smart to transition right into a long-term program whenever possible.

In a long-term drug rehab in Petoskey, results tend to be higher because it will take the thirty days you will spend in a short term drug rehab in Petoskey only to overcome all the acute physical problems one experiences when just getting off of alcohol and drugs. Someone that is recently getting off of heroin for instance will experience serious withdrawal symptoms for around a week and then less serious symptoms including extreme urges to use for several more weeks. It's challenging to focus on the actual rehab process which addresses what causes one's addiction with all of this happening, so being able to become rehabilitated and also have any chance at long-term abstinence is a lot more realistic inside a long-term Petoskey drug rehab. So after detoxification and after conquering the withdrawal symptoms, men and women within a long-term drug rehab in Petoskey can take part in rehabilitation services which will handle the real reasons that they started using drugs and alcohol in the first place. This typically has a lot more to do with deep underlying issues that have nothing to do with the acute physical problems handled in short-term Petoskey rehabilitation facility.

Regardless of whether someone chooses and long or short term center it is important that anyone searching for rehab in the drug rehab in Petoskey realize that their addiction isn't going to be handled simply by detoxing and becoming sober. Although this is of course a big win for those involved, and very often the person believes in their own mind they can continue to be sober, this in nearly every situation just isn't true. For this reason people who detox by themselves relapse shortly afterwards, which is the reason detox only alcohol and drug treatment facilities in Petoskey don't work. You can find facilities in Petoskey whose only purpose is to deliver detox solutions, and even though this is helpful and beneficial in terms of short term advantages and objectives, those who obtain no further treatment services in a drug rehab in Petoskey following detoxification fare just as well as those who obtained no treatment services at all, i.e. they relapse soon after. Detoxification only centers are a fantastic place to start, but it is not the end of the road for a person who wants to uncover and take care of the real reasons they became involved with substance abuse that is what will help them stay abstinent. So following detoxification, the transition to a short-term or preferably long-term drug rehab in Petoskey is always strongly recommended. Or possibly just begin in a long-term drug rehab in Petoskey from the beginning to cut out the middle man.

There are also programs in Petoskey which don't actually deliver any rehabilitation at all but make use of medical drugs to help individuals get off of drugs. Methadone programs for instance have been in existence for a very long time, first utilized with the intention to help heroin addicts stop drug seeking habits and prevent effects of heroin use like criminal activity and its penalties in addition to health effects. Most of these facilities which now include buprenorphine and several other medicines are called opioid maintenance therapy, and this therapy now addresses problems associated with prescription medication abuse since these drugs are now abused at comparable rates to heroin these days. The reason some individuals may turn to this sort of facility like a solution is that they feel they can't handle the urges and withdrawal symptoms that they will ultimately suffer from when they stop using all at once. So as an alternative, the apparently easy way out is to use methadone or even a comparable medicine which eliminates urges and withdrawal symptoms, but itself is a regiment which itself must be taken care of in order to avoid craving and withdrawal. So this too isn't an extremely ideal circumstance for a person who planned to fully remove substances from their life that they depend upon for either physical or mental fulfillment.
